BukkitTelnet
============
BukkitTelnet is a Telnet server for Minecraft. It allows you to remotely administrate your server via any Telnet client.
BukkitTelnet is a fork of MCTelnet that is designed for servers with multiple administrators who all have the same full permissions. It allows for login under any username provided that the proper password is supplied.
MCTelnet was originally created by bekvon. I modified it heavily to be better suited for the [TotalFreedomServer](http://totalfreedom.me/), and eventually renamed it.
